Unleash Your Inner Shaman: Netflix Announces Shaman King Flowers Streaming on April 21

Netflix is gearing up to enchant anime fans once again with the highly anticipated addition to their catalogue: Shaman King Flowers. Set to hit screens on April 21, this sequel to the beloved television adaptation of Hiroyuki Takei’s Shaman King manga promises to reignite the mystical world of shamans and spirits.

Having premiered on January 9, the anime has already captured the hearts of viewers during its initial run of 13 episodes on TV Tokyo. Now, fans in the United States and Canada can rejoice as Netflix brings this captivating series to their screens.

Venturing deeper into the realm of Shaman King, the sequel introduces a new generation of characters, including Hana Asakura, voiced by the talented Yōko Hikasa, and Amidamaru, portrayed by Katsuyuki Konishi. With a stellar cast breathing life into these mystical personas, viewers can expect a captivating journey filled with intrigue and adventure.

Directed by Takeshi Furuta, known for his work on Utano☆Princesama Legend Star, Shaman King Flowers promises to deliver the same level of excitement and magic that fans have come to love. Accompanied by an enchanting soundtrack featuring the opening theme “Turn the World” by Nana Mizuki, and the ending theme “Dear Panta Rhei” by Sumire Uesaka, this anime is set to leave a lasting impression.

For those unfamiliar with the Shaman King universe, fear not! The original manga series, which began in Jump X magazine in 2012, has garnered a dedicated following worldwide. With Kodansha USA Publishing releasing English translations of both Shaman King Flowers and its predecessor, fans can delve into the captivating lore that has captivated audiences for years.

This latest installment comes hot on the heels of the successful 2021 reboot of the original Shaman King anime, which saw 52 exhilarating episodes. With the new series set to continue the legacy of its predecessor, fans can look forward to immersing themselves in a world where spirits and shamans collide.
